Interactive projects for kids, lawn games and live performances are featured at free Arts Day festival in Weston. The free festival in 2026 is 12 p.m. to 4 p.m. Sunday, March 8, and it includes graffiti wall, balloon art and tattoo art. Performances include local school bands and drama troupes. The popular and free Southern Cross Observation Deck is open in Miami-Dade at Bill Sadowski Park. The public is invited to visit with amateur astronomers from 7:30 to 10 p.m. each Saturday, weather permitting. A sense of wonder and discovery draws our eyes to the night sky.
